Migori County Governor Obado has on Monday been granted a bail of Ksh8.75 million or a Ksh73.4 million bond when he appeared before Chief Magistrate Lawrence Mugambi to answer charges of embezzlement of public funds. Obado had been arrested alongside his family members on August 26th in Kisii after DPP Nordin Haji approved the arrest and prosecution of the county chief over the embezzlement of about 73 million shillings.
The case rings familiar to other county governors who have been found culpable in various instances including the Nairobi Governor Mike Sonko, former Kiambu Governor Ferdinand Waititu and Samburu Governor Moses Lenolkulal. The magistrate directed that the Governor be escorted to pick his belongings from the county offices.
